## v2.8.0 — Setting renamed

Heads up, on-call: in Cartwheel's catalog service, `CACHE_FLUSH_KEY` is now `CATALOG_INVALIDATION_SECRET`. Same behavior — it authenticates purge requests to the invalidation endpoint — but the old name is ignored as of this release, so stale product pages mean you forgot to migrate. Update your `.env` and add the renamed entry here:

secret setting of yajog-taguf: ARCHIVE_KEY3=051

Heads up, new folks: the Chalkwright timetable solver stopped producing Tuesday's draft schedules because the key it uses to fetch room-capacity data from the Roomledger service expired over the weekend. Classic. Ops minted a replacement this morning and the solver is happy again. If your local runs still fail, swap in the fresh key below.

gateway credential: kto3_qfe

## Changelog — Proselint-ish v2.4

Renamed `DOCLINT_STRICT` to `DOCLINT_LEVEL` because "strict" was doing three jobs at once. It now takes `relaxed`, `standard`, or `pedantic`. The old name still works but logs a deprecation warning, so don't panic if CI gets chatty. Reviewers: migration is a one-line env change. While you're in there, the linter's rule-registry sync now needs an access token, which goes on the very next line.

sealed setting: VAULT_KEY20=69e2a0b23f1a79fbf692

Subject: Cut-over done — session-token refresh fix (Brindlecore Auth)

Team,

The fix for the session-token refresh bug shipped at 02:00 and the cut-over is complete. Tokens no longer expire mid-refresh, so forced re-logins should stop. If customers still report logouts, capture the token age before escalating. The refresh service now runs with the following configuration values.

deployment values, yadup-kadug:
[sorys]
port = 5672
team = noveth
host = sorys.orvexcorp.example
region = south-4
access_code = ac_deddc1
timeout_ms = 1500